How much do entry level invoice analyst j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level invoice analyst in the United States is $27.77,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.23 and $30.05 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Is an entry level invoice analyst an entry level job?

Yes, an entry level invoice analyst position is typically considered an entry level job, suitable for candidates with little to no prior experience in finance or accounting. It usually involves basic data entry, invoice processing, and familiarity with accounting software, making it accessible for recent graduates or those new to the field.

What does an entry level invoice analyst do?

An entry-level invoice analyst reviews and processes invoices to ensure accuracy and compliance with company policies. They often use accounting software and may verify billing details, resolve discrepancies, and support accounts payable functions in a team environment.

Job Description
Analysts act as consultants to provide the research and insight that clients need to make an informed, data-backed decision. This team plays a critical role in supporting engagements where revenue is generated through managed billing. Under this business model, our company manages all billing and invoicing between expert consultants and attorney clients.
On a daily basis, you will:
  • Receive and review invoices from different individuals (Experts) for accuracy and completeness, ensuring all required itemization is included.
  • Enter invoice data into Salesforce and generate corresponding client-facing invoices.
  • Send invoices to attorney clients and follow up as needed to ensure timely payment.
  • Maintain clear, consistent communication with both experts and attorneys via email and phone.
  • Manage follow-ups and clarifications related to invoice submissions, payments, and related documentation.
  • Provide exceptional customer service and maintain professionalism in all interactions.
